The STIHL FS 45 is a lightweight, straight-shaft grass trimmer designed for residential use. This service manual covers essential maintenance, troubleshooting, and repair procedures for the FS 45 model, including the engine, fuel system, cutting head, drive shaft, and safety features. Below are key sections for specifications, maintenance schedules, troubleshooting, disassembly/assembly, and parts identification.
Key components: 2-stroke engine, straight shaft, loop handle, bump-feed cutting head.
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Engine Type | STIHL 2-MIX, single-cylinder, 2-stroke |
| Displacement | 27.2 cc |
| Power Output | 0.9 kW (1.2 bhp) |
| Fuel Tank Capacity | 0.47 liters (16 oz) |
| Oil Tank Capacity | 0.26 liters (8.8 oz) for automatic oiler |
| Shaft Type | Straight, solid drive shaft |
| Cutting Head | STIHL AutoCut C 5-2 bump-feed head |
| Cutting Tool | 2.4 mm diameter nylon line |
| Weight (without cutter) | 5.2 kg (11.5 lbs) |
| Sound Pressure Level | Typically 94 dB(A) |

Access engine components by removing the recoil starter and air filter cover.
Spark Plug: NGK BPMR7A (gap 0.5 mm / 0.020 in). Check and clean every 25 hours.

Major component removal procedures.
| Component | Procedure |
|---|---|
| Carburetor | Remove air filter cover, disconnect fuel lines and throttle linkage, remove mounting nuts. |
| Ignition Module | Remove recoil starter, disconnect kill wire, remove mounting screws. |
| Fuel Tank | Drain fuel, remove mounting screws, disconnect fuel lines and primer bulb. |
| Drive Shaft | Remove cutting head, disconnect from engine clutch, slide out of shaft tube. |
| Gearhead | Remove cutting head, remove retaining nut, pull gearhead from shaft. |
